8. What is the frequency of the quartz oscillator?
The movement utilizes the industry-standard 32,768 Hz frequency. This specific frequency is used because it is a power of 2 ($2^{15}$), which can be easily divided down to exactly 1 pulse per second by the integrated circuit. This digital division is what provides the incredible reliability Timex is known for.

9. What exactly is Indiglo technology?
Indiglo is an electroluminescent technology. It works by converting electrical energy directly into light via a thin phosphor layer behind the dial. When the crown is pressed, the entire dial glows with a uniform, blue-green light. H.E. Phillips Ltd technical data shows this is superior to traditional lume paint because it provides 100% brightness on demand.

20. Why is brass used for the case body?
Brass acts as an ideal damper for watch movements. It is a dense but relatively soft metal compared to steel, allowing it to absorb the energy of an impact rather than transferring it directly to the quartz oscillator. Timex has used brass for their cases for over a century to ensure optimal resilience standards.

26. Is the quartz movement resistant to magnetism?
Yes, quartz movements are inherently more resistant to magnetic fields than mechanical watches. However, very strong magnets can temporarily disrupt the stepping motor. Once removed from the field, it will resume normal operation. This model is ideal for electronic-heavy environments.
27. Does the T2H371 meet shock resistance standards?
The T2H371 is built to standard horological shock resistance specifications. The quartz movement is mounted in a protective spacer that absorbs vibrations. While it is not a specialized ruggedized watch, it is designed to survive the typical activities of professional life easily.
28. How does temperature affect the T2H371?
The quartz crystal is cut to be most accurate at room temperature (approx 25°C). Extreme heat or cold can cause the vibration frequency to shift slightly, leading to small deviations. The T2H371 is engineered to perform consistently across standard UK temperature ranges.
